If you lived in Dominica instead of Venezuela, you would:

Health

live 4.9 years longer

In Venezuela, the average life expectancy is 73 years (70 years for men, 77 years for women) as of 2022. In Dominica, that number is 78 years (75 years for men, 81 years for women) as of 2022.

Economy

make 28.5% more money

Venezuela has a GDP per capita of $7,704 as of 2018, while in Dominica, the GDP per capita is $9,900 as of 2020.

be 12.4% less likely to live below the poverty line

In Venezuela, 33.1% live below the poverty line as of 2015. In Dominica, however, that number is 29.0% as of 2009.

be 3.3 times more likely to be unemployed

In Venezuela, 6.9% of adults are unemployed as of 2018. In Dominica, that number is 23.0% as of 2000.

Life

be 36.4% less likely to die during infancy

In Venezuela, approximately 17.7 children (per 1,000 live births) die before they reach the age of one as of 2022. In Dominica, on the other hand, 11.3 children do as of 2022.

have 19.5% fewer children

In Venezuela, there are approximately 17.3 babies per 1,000 people as of 2022. In Dominica, there are 13.9 babies per 1,000 people as of 2022.

Expenditures

spend 3.8 times more on education

Venezuela spends 1.3% of its total GDP on education as of 2017. Dominica spends 5.0% of total GDP on education as of 2020.

Geography

see 94.7% less coastline

Venezuela has a total of 2,800 km of coastline. In Dominica, that number is 148 km.


The statistics above were calculated using the following data sources: The World Factbook.

Dominica: At a glance

Dominica is a sovereign country in Central America/Caribbean, with a total land area of approximately 751 sq km. Dominica was the last of the Caribbean islands to be colonized by Europeans due chiefly to the fierce resistance of the native Caribs. France ceded possession to Great Britain in 1763, which made the island a colony in 1805. In 1980, two years after independence, Dominica's fortunes improved when a corrupt and tyrannical administration was replaced by that of Mary Eugenia CHARLES, the first female prime minister in the Caribbean, who remained in office for 15 years. Some 3,000 Carib Indians still living on Dominica are the only pre-Columbian population remaining in the eastern Caribbean.
